acp青年计算机编程大赛比什么

fiy 其他 36

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    ACP青年计算机编程大赛是一个面向青年程序员的编程比赛。该比赛旨在通过竞赛的形式,促进青年计算机编程人才的培养和发展。与其他编程比赛相比,ACP青年计算机编程大赛有以下几个特点:

    1. 青年参赛者:ACP青年计算机编程大赛主要面向年龄在18岁至30岁之间的青年程序员。这个年龄段正是计算机编程人才培养的黄金时期,通过参加这样的比赛,青年程序员可以锻炼自己的编程技能,提升自己的竞争力。

    2. 多领域竞赛:ACP青年计算机编程大赛包含了多个领域的竞赛项目,如算法设计、数据结构、人工智能、网络安全等。这些领域涵盖了计算机编程的核心知识和技能,参赛者可以根据自己的兴趣和专长选择适合自己的项目参赛。

    3. 团队合作:ACP青年计算机编程大赛鼓励参赛者以团队的形式参赛。团队合作不仅可以提高编程效率,还能培养参赛者的团队协作能力和沟通能力。此外,团队合作还可以促进不同领域的知识交流和合作,推动计算机编程领域的跨学科发展。

    4. 实战经验:ACP青年计算机编程大赛注重实战能力的培养。参赛者需要在规定的时间内完成一系列编程任务,这些任务往往是实际项目中常见的问题。通过参加比赛,参赛者可以锻炼自己的问题解决能力和编程实践经验,为未来的职业发展打下坚实的基础。

    总之,ACP青年计算机编程大赛是一个面向青年程序员的编程比赛,通过竞赛的形式促进青年计算机编程人才的培养和发展。参加这样的比赛可以提高编程技能、拓宽知识领域、培养团队合作能力,对于青年程序员的个人成长和职业发展都具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    ACP青年计算机编程大赛是一项面向青年程序员的编程竞赛,与其他类似的计算机编程比赛相比,具有以下特点:

    1. 青年参赛者:ACP青年计算机编程大赛主要面向青年程序员,参赛者一般为高中生、大学生或初入职场的年轻人。这使得比赛更具有年轻化和活力。

    2. 多种编程语言:ACP青年计算机编程大赛允许参赛者使用多种编程语言进行比赛,包括但不限于C、C++、Python、Java等。这使得比赛更加灵活,能够吸引更多不同编程语言背景的参赛者。

    3. 多个比赛阶段:ACP青年计算机编程大赛通常分为初赛、复赛和决赛三个阶段。初赛一般为线上赛,复赛和决赛则为线下赛。这种分阶段的比赛形式能够筛选出优秀的参赛者,并且增加了比赛的悬念和竞争性。

    4. 实际问题解决:ACP青年计算机编程大赛的题目通常都是实际问题,参赛者需要通过编程解决这些问题。这使得比赛更贴近实际应用,能够锻炼参赛者的实际编程能力。

    5. 团队合作:ACP青年计算机编程大赛鼓励参赛者组成团队参赛,团队成员之间需要相互合作、协调和分工。这种团队合作的方式能够培养参赛者的团队协作能力和沟通能力。

    总而言之,ACP青年计算机编程大赛与其他计算机编程比赛相比,更加注重年轻人的参与、多样化的编程语言、多个比赛阶段、实际问题解决和团队合作,为青年程序员提供了一个锻炼自己编程能力和团队合作能力的平台。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    ACM-ICPC(国际大学生程序设计竞赛)是世界上最著名的大学生计算机编程竞赛之一,也是青年计算机编程大赛的一种比赛形式。ACM-ICPC由国际计算机联合会(ACM)、IBM和世界各地大学共同组织和支持。该竞赛旨在提高大学生在算法、数据结构、计算机程序设计等方面的能力,培养他们的团队协作精神和创新思维能力。

    ACM-ICPC比赛通常由三人组成一个队伍,他们需要在规定时间内解决一系列的编程问题。比赛采用的是竞赛形式,参赛队伍需要根据题目要求设计并实现算法,然后提交代码进行评测。评测结果根据代码的正确性、运行时间和内存消耗等指标进行评判,最终得分高的队伍获胜。

    ACM-ICPC比赛的内容主要涉及算法和数据结构,题目难度从简单到复杂不等。参赛队伍需要在给定的时间内解决尽可能多的问题,并保证代码的正确性和效率。比赛期间,队伍之间可以相互交流和讨论,但不能查阅资料或与外界联系。

    ACM-ICPC比赛的操作流程一般如下:

    1. 队伍报名:参赛队伍需要提前报名,并提交队员的相关信息。每个队伍一般由三名队员组成,其中一人担任队长。

    2. 比赛准备:比赛前,参赛队伍需要熟悉比赛规则和操作流程,熟悉竞赛平台的使用方法。他们可以在练习赛中熟悉比赛环境和题目类型,提高自己的编程能力和团队协作能力。

    3. 比赛开始:比赛开始后,参赛队伍需要在规定的时间内解决尽可能多的编程问题。他们可以使用任何编程语言,并且可以使用自己的电脑进行编程。

    4. 解题过程:参赛队伍需要仔细阅读题目,分析问题,设计算法,并将代码实现。在代码编写完成后,他们需要将代码提交到评测系统进行评判。

    5. 评测结果:评测系统会对提交的代码进行评判,根据代码的正确性和效率给出相应的评分。参赛队伍可以根据评测结果进行调试和优化,重新提交代码。

    6. 比赛结束:比赛结束后,参赛队伍的成绩会被汇总并公布。根据得分高低,评委会决定比赛的名次和奖项。

    ACM-ICPC比赛对参赛者的编程能力和团队合作能力提出了很高的要求。参加这样的比赛可以锻炼和提高参赛者的算法设计和编程能力,培养他们的团队协作和解决问题的能力。同时,比赛也为青年计算机编程爱好者提供了一个交流和学习的平台,可以从其他参赛者的代码和思路中获得启发和提高。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部